Terry was the first girl I asked to go steady. I asked my parents for an initial ring for my 12th birthday, which they were good enough to buy for me. It was 6th grade at the Jackson Elementary annex. I had decided to give Terry the ring at our morning recess, and my heart was pounding as the time drew near. I was scared to death! The bell rang and we all headed outdoors. As several of us guys were running out to play ball, I asked Terry if she would hold my stuff for me. I gave her several items and then I took off the ring and handed it to her, as well. As I ran off, I hollered back, “Thanks, and you can keep the ring!” By the time recess was over, she had already taped the ring so it would fit her finger and she was wearing it! I was very glad to see she had forgiven me for being such a coward. I will always remember Terry as my first steady girlfriend.
